Kate Ceberano awarded the Order of Australia on Queen’s Birthday Honours List

She’s one of the country’s best known and beloved entertainers and this year, Kate Ceberano has been awarded another special note of recognition, the Order of Australia. Revealed as part of this year’s Queen’s Birthday Honours List, Ceberano is one of many esteemed individuals who have made the list.

Ceberano has been officially recognised for her contributions and service to the performing arts, notably as a singer, as well as her contributions to charitable organisations. It’s been a big few years for Kate, who recently celebrated a successful 35 years in the Australian music industry, marking the milestone with the release of ANTHOLOGY, Ceberano’s 24th studio release.

She says of her OAM recognition, “I am so very proud and honoured to be receiving this award from this great country of Australia that I love.”
